Dash Board: Screen 3 for AC Power
Screen 3 displays the Inverter Power (Inv. P) and the Grid Output
Power (Grid. P)
• Pressing the Right Key
will change the display to Screen 4 for
Frequency
• Pressing the Left Key
will change the display to Screen 2 for
AC Currents
NOTE:
In Inverter Mode, the output power will be equal to the Inverter
Power (Inv. P). Grid Power (Grid. P) will show 0.0 W.
In Pass-through Mode, the output power will be equal to Grid
Power (Grid. P). Inverter Power (Inv. P) will show 0.0W

Dash Board: Screen 4 for Frequency
Screen 4 displays the Inverter Frequency (Inv. F) and the Grid
Frequency (Grid. F)
• Pressing the Right Key
will change the display to Screen 5 for
DC Input Voltage
• Pressing the Left Key
will change the display to Screen 3 for
AC Power
NOTE:
In Inverter Mode, the output frequency will be equal to the
Inverter Frequency (Inv. F).
In Pass-through Mode, the output frequency will be equal to Grid
Frequency (Grid. F).

9.8 PROGRAMMING OF OPERATING PARAMETERS
The values / settings of various operating parameters can be programmed to suit specific application
requirements. Section 10 provides details of the Default settings and the procedure to change the settings,
if required, to suit the desired operating conditions.
Some of the more important parameters to be checked / programmed are as follows:
• Output voltage through programmable parameter “Output V”. Refer to Section 10.2.3.1
• Output frequency through programmable parameter “Output FREQ”. Refer to Section 10.2.3.2
